Emma is an experienced strategic leader, specializing in professional development at C-suite and senior management levels. With a track record for delivering solutions across a broad range of global sectors and industries, Emma brings a wealth of experience and a deep passion for continuing professional development.
Emma is a Fellow and Advisory Board Member of the Learning Performance Institute (LPI), holds certifications from the Institute of Directors (IoD) and Association for Talent Development (ATD), and is a former Education Committee member at the European Confederation of Directors Associations (ecoDa).
Emma spent nearly a decade with the Institute of Directors leading the strategic direction of the IoD’s global professional development courses including the prestigious Chartered Director qualification. After leaving the IoD, Emma joined HR technology and services company, Connectr, initially as interim COO, and then permanently as Chief Commercial Officer. Now, Emma is Director of Global Membership and Programs at WeQual, an organisation on a mission to drive equality in the world’s largest organisations. Emma’s role at WeQual aligns beautifully with her core values and purpose – supporting women and all talent to achieve their career goals, and organisations to thrive through inclusive leadership practice.
Emma also spent five years with Reed Learning as their Strategic Partnership Manager, working with over 100 clients, external partners, and awarding bodies. During this time, Emma also designed and delivered learning programs, including internationally recognized qualifications.
